Nesourdnahunk Lake is on the western edge of Baxter Park. Get there by going to Greenville, north to Golden Road, east to Telos Road, north to Nesourdnahunk. Also get there by going west of Millinocket, past Baxter. Great fishing with a great campground on edge of lake.

Flyfishing only on a larger lake. 10-12" brookies all day; dry flies on top in AM and eve, nymphs all day long. Fried trout for breakfast with scrambled eggs and home fries. If you dont catch trout, you substitute thinnly sliced venison steaks with the eggs, which you brought from home to keep from starving. I do a 4-day weekend here in late May with son, then wife and I go in early Sept. Heaven. But dont tell anyone.
